  1. My keyboard stops working for a few seconds and then it resumes.


    Hi. A few days ago, I bought a Redragon Kumara K552 wired. At first everything seemed to be ok. But recently I started to have some problems.

    Sometimes, the keyboard just disconnects completely and turns off this happens with my mouse too, and I have to reboot all the computer because it just keeps not recognizing them. I have to say this only happened two times, but it's ridiculously uncomfortable.

    Commonly, the keyboard experiments some micro disconnections: when I'm writing, it simply stops the input for a few moments and then gets back to it, or just keeps a key spamming the time this 'lag' happens the RGB doesn't turn off, so I think it doesn't disconnects completely, but I don't understand why it keeps doing that.

    Other times, there are some specific keys that Windows fails to recognize and write them correctly, while all the others work as good as they are supposed to. This keys vary from time to time, so I don't think the problem is in the keyboard itself.

    I have already uninstalled and installed the keyboard and everything. The drivers aren't the problem here because it is a 'plug & play' keyboard and doesn't have any.

    The keyboard works fine as I've tried it on another pc and it worked perfectly.

  3. Microsoft keyboard (wireless) does not work after resuming from hibernation.

    Hardware:

    • Microsoft EKZ-00001 Modern Keyboard with Fingerprint ID.
    • Dell OptiPlex 3050
    • USB Dongle - Asus BT400

    After resuming my PC from hibernation, the keyboard doesn't work. I use the keyboard in the wireless mode via an USB dongle. I'm using the latest version
    of Windows 10 with all updates applied. This issue did not happen in 2017 and the larger part of 2018. Since one of the larger updates in the last months of 2018, this issue started happening. An update must have changed something in the configuration of Windows
    10. No other changes have been applied to my PC.

    I've found a work around:

    When resumed from hibernation, and the keyboard is not working, use the mouse to click to hibernate, at the login screen. The
    PC will go into hibernation again. When the PC is off, turn it on and when it resumes from hiberation the keyboard works. This means I will have to hibernate and resume the PC twice every time to get the keyboard
    to work.

    Let’s troubleshoot the issue by referring to these methods and check the issue status:

    Method 1:

    Refer to the link to run the troubleshooter:

    Windows has a built-in troubleshooter to check and fix issues with Hardware and Devices. I would suggest you to run this troubleshooter to check if the issue is with your Devices.

    Refer these steps:

    • Press Windows key +X, select Control panel.
    • Change the view by option on the top right to Large icons.
    • Click on troubleshooting and click on the view all option on the left panel.
    • Run the Hardware and Devices.

    Method 2:

    Let’s try updating the driver for the mouse and keyboard and verify the results. Follow the steps:

    a) Press Windows and X key together and select Device Manager.

    b) Locate the Key board device icon. Right click on the driver icon.

    c) Select Update driver software.

    c) Select "browse my computer for a driver software".

    d) Select “Let me pick from a list of device drivers on my computer”.

    e) Select the driver option according your device model and installed.

    f) If this does not work, follow the steps from ‘a’ to ‘c’ and select “Search automatically for the updated driver”.

    g) Choose the same steps to update the driver for keyboard as well.

    Check if it resolves the issue. If not, I would suggest you to download and install the latest available drivers for the keyboard from manufacturer website of the laptop. If the issue still persists, install the driver in Windows Compatibility mode and check
    if that helps.

    Method 3: Compatibility mode

    Follow the steps below on how to install driver in compatibility mode:

    1. Download the driver from the manufacturer’s website and save it on your local disk.

    2. Right click on the setup file of the driver and select “Properties”.

    3. Select “Compatibility” Tab.

    4. Place a check mark next to “Run this program in Compatibility mode” and select operating system from the drop down list.

    5. Let the driver install and then check the functionality.
